Synopsis

Gina Jackson’s family has grown smaller in recent years. First, she lost her grandmother, then two years ago she lost her beloved grandfather. Now, the only person Gina truly cares about is her mother, Helen.

Unfortunately, neither woman saw the smooth New Yorker, Bruce Franklin, coming. Neither had a clue about Franklin’s true motives but both will pay a price for his actions, although in different ways.

With her mother distraught, Gina decides she has no choice but to right a wrong. A foolhardy trip to New York ensues, but Gina quickly learns that the Big Apple is an unforgiving city — her confidence tested to the limit within the first twenty-four hours. Then, in one moment, everything changes when Gina crosses paths with a mysterious Londoner by the name of Clement — a man as big as he is brash.

The fiercely independent Gina is then presented with a choice. Should she continue the search for Bruce Franklin alone, or would recruiting an ally prove a wise move? The first option seems rash, the second a gamble. All Gina knows is that she simply has to find Franklin.

Teaming up with a mildly unhinged man mountain from Camden might be a gamble, but with high risk comes high reward… or so Gina hopes.
